Bobbie Ann Mason - Video Tape; Signature: Contemporary Southern Writers Author:Bobbie Ann Mason Bobbie Ann Mason (from back cover): "I think my writing is rooted in this place", says Bobbie Ann Mason of Western Kentucky, where she grew up and where her family has lived for five generations. This program explores how Mason's experiences in the region translate into evocative short stories and novels. Mason discusses here award-winning novel... more »s, In Country and Feather Crowns, and reads from her story collections. Also included are a clip from the feature film of In Country and commentary from Roger Angell, The New Yorker editor who encouraged Mason's early writing. The Signature Series is composed of one-hour videos on some of the most important writers in our time. The authors read from their own works and talk about their lives, their influences, their successes, and their failures. Students will gain insight into the writing process and learn creative strategies for turning their own experiences into compelling writing. This series is useful for courses in American literature, contemporary fiction, theater, women's studies, and Southern fiction.« less
